We have 500+ members in SEFI. There is a healthy mix of academicians, young turks, grandfathers & students. We can tap this resource to create, what I can coin as an "Internet based Voluntary Accreditation Program (call it eVAP)" by SEFI.
The very basics are something like this. We can form a blue ribbon group (I hate the word committee, as they tend to go on & on...), who can design this Program. Any member interested in going thru this program (that is why it is called Voluntary), can download the test material and submit it back via email within a prescribed time frame (that is why it is called Internet based), which can then be evaluated by the blue ribbon group & some rating (信用)的响应。成员的哈ve taken this Program, along with their credits are then permanently displayed on the web site. These credits can become something like a credit-rating-system used for banks & limited companies, and may start having an impact on the profession and the market forces. We can have a trial run with a particular field of structural engineering, say building design (maximum practitioners in this field, and maximum need for accreditation is also for this field)
Now this is a very basic sketch of an idea, which can be developed quickly thru an interactive discussion group specially set up for this at SEFI. And within a week we can be ready with a framework.
